#1 Best Overall: Roborock S8 MaxV Ultra
The Roborock S8 MaxV Ultra earns our top spot by excelling in every category. Its 10,000 Pa HyperForce suction is the most powerful we have tested in its class, and the ReactiveAI 3.0 obstacle avoidance system correctly identified and avoided 71 of 73 test objects — a near-perfect score.
The FlexiArm side brush is a genuine innovation, extending to reach corners and edges that traditional side brushes miss. Combined with the hot water mop washing system, the S8 MaxV Ultra delivers the most thorough clean we have ever tested from a robot vacuum.
Best for: Large homes, mixed flooring, pet owners who want the absolute best
#2 Best Suction: Dreame X60 Max Ultra Complete
The Dreame X60 Max Ultra Complete's 35,000 Pa suction is extraordinary — nearly 3.5x more powerful than the Roborock on paper. In practice, this translates to exceptional carpet deep cleaning and the ability to pick up debris that other vacuums leave behind.
Its ultra-slim 3.13-inch profile is a genuine differentiator, allowing it to clean under sofas, beds, and cabinets that other robots cannot reach. If you have low furniture or deep-pile carpets, the X60 Max Ultra is the clear choice.
Best for: Homes with deep-pile carpets, low furniture, or heavy debris loads
#3 Best for Ease of Use: iRobot Roomba j9+
The iRobot Roomba j9+ is the most user-friendly premium robot vacuum available. Setup takes under 10 minutes, the app is intuitive for all ages, and the PrecisionVision obstacle avoidance system correctly identified 80+ object types in our testing — the highest count of any model tested.
While it lacks mopping capability, its vacuum performance is excellent, and iRobot's software ecosystem — including Imprint Smart Mapping and seasonal cleaning schedules — is the most mature in the industry.
Best for: First-time robot vacuum buyers, pet owners, those who prioritize simplicity
Quick Comparison Table
| Model | Score | Price | Suction | Mopping | Self-Clean |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Roborock S8 MaxV Ultra | 9.6/10 | $1,799 | 10,000 Pa | ✓ Hot Water | Full |
| Dreame X60 Max Ultra | 9.4/10 | $1,699 | 35,000 Pa | ✓ 212°F | Full |
| iRobot Roomba j9+ | 9.0/10 | $1,099 | High-Efficiency | ✗ | Auto-Empty |
| Ecovacs X5 Pro Omni | 8.8/10 | $1,299 | 12,800 Pa | ✓ Hot Water | Full |
| Narwal Freo X Ultra | 8.6/10 | $1,099 | 8,200 Pa | ✓ Spinning | Full |
| Samsung Jet Bot AI+ | 8.3/10 | $999 | 6,000 Pa | ✗ | Auto-Empty |
